Apostle Cleopas of the Seventy

Also known as Cleopas of Emmaus · Cleophas

One of the Seventy; the disciple who, with a companion, met the risen Christ on the road to Emmaus and knew Him in the breaking of bread (Luke 24).

Notes

Orthodox tradition sometimes identifies him with Clopas/Cleophas (Jn 19:25), kinsman of the Lord; sources vary on whether they are one person.
